On the Cover: Isola di Loreto

Nestled in the tranquil waters of Iseo Lake in the Lombardy region of Italy, Isola di Loreto stands as a picturesque testament to the rich history and natural beauty that the area has to offer. Although lesser-known compared to its famous counterparts in the larger Italian lakes, this tiny island captivates visitors with its serene ambiance, historical significance, and


online + newspaper

This section of the article is only available for our subscribers. Please click here to subscribe or login if you are already a subscriber.